a single
–ended current source/sink phase detector output and a double
–ended phase detector output. Both phase detectors have linear transfer functions (no dead zones). The maximum current of the single
–ended phase detector output is determined by an external resistor tied from the Rx pin to ground. This current can be varied via the serial port. The MC145200 features logic
–level converters and high
–voltage phase/ frequency detectors; the detector supply may range up to 9.5 V. The MC145201 has lower
–voltage phase/frequency detectors optimized for single
–supply systems of 5 V ± 10%. Each part in.
